Engineering Manager - Data Automation
Confirmed live in the last 24 hours
Klaviyo
Job Description
At Klaviyo, we value the unique backgrounds, experiences and perspectives each Klaviyo (we call ourselves Klaviyos) brings to our workplace each and every day. We believe everyone deserves a fair shot at success and appreciate the experiences each person brings beyond the traditional job requirements. If you’re a close but not exact match with the description, we hope you’ll still consider applying. Want to learn more about life at Klaviyo? Visit klaviyo.com/careers to see how we empower creators to own their own destiny.
At Klaviyo, we love tackling tough engineering problems and look for engineers who specialize in certain areas but are passionate about building, owning & scaling features end to end from scratch and breaking through any obstacle or technical challenge in their way. We push each other to move out of our comfort zone, learn new technologies and work hard to ensure each day is better than the last.
Team Overview:
Klaviyo operates a real-time data analytics platform written primarily in Python that is built for massive scale and hosted on Amazon Web Services (AWS). The Data Automation team builds tooling and establishes best practices and technology choices that help enable the Data Platform area to power core Klaviyo functionality and generate data-driven insights.
As a founding member on the Data Automation team, you will have ownership over defining the technical and organizational vision for the team. You will be responsible for leading the team to design and build systems that help us operate our mission critical analytics infrastructure.
Team Tech Stack:
- AWS
- Terraform
- Python
- Kubernetes
- Clickhouse
- DynamoDB
- MySQL
- Kafka
- Spark
- Flink
- Airflow
How You'll Make a Difference
- You will be responsible for building and managing a team of 7+ engineers to fulfill your data automation vision and roadmap.
- Responsible for coaching engineers, managing/reviewing technical documentation and articulating a phased approach to achieving the team's overall technical vision.
- Be responsible for the mission, technical direction and operations of projects that have immediate impact.
- Wholly owning the frameworks that enable us to provision, update, test, monitor, and scale infrastructure to power features that 183,000+ customers rely on daily to reach 4B+ consumers to drive their business forward.
- Optimizing infrastructure with the teams that own Klaviyo’s analytics system that provides insight on hundreds of terabytes of data.
- Transform workflows by putting AI at the center, building smarter systems and ways of working from the ground up.
Required Skills
- BA or BS Degree in Computer Science, related field, or equivalent experience
- 8+ years of software engineering experience in a DevOps environment with specific experience in data processing systems.
- 3+ years of people management experience
- Hands-on experience designing, building, and operating reliable, fault-tolerant, and high performance distributed systems
- Ability to handle yourself in outage situations and to drive failures to root cause analysis and prevention of future issues
- Experience writing code using best practices in a language such as Python, Ruby, Go, etc.
- You’ve already experimented with AI in work or personal projects, and you’re excited to dive in and learn fast. You’re hungry to responsibly explore new AI tools and workflows, finding ways to make your work smarter and more efficient.
- Proven ability to come up to speed quickly
- Hybrid office work 3x/week out of our Boston office
We use Covey as part of our hiring and / o
Similar Jobs
EMC Insurance
Senior Data Engineer
Synchrony Financial
Sr. Analyst, SOX IT Testing (L09)
Western Union
Agent Oversight Analyst
Minnesota State
Computer Systems Networking, Cybersecurity and Networking Faculty
Nasdaq
Quality Engineering - Senior Specialist
Northern Trust